Factory Overhead Controllable Variance Bellingham Company produced 3,100 units of product that required 6 standard direct labor hours per unit. The standard variable overhead cost per unit is $5.40 per direct labor hour. The actual variable factory overhead was $104,360. Determine the variable factory overhead controllable variance. Enter a favorable variance as a negative number using a minus sign and an unfavorable variance as a positive number. Favorable
